I was wondering if Java Xalan is still active? The mail from Roman Shaposhnik on the xalan-j-users mailing list from october 2018 [1] suggests that there's not really any activity any longer and the last release is from April 2014.

I also don't see any new commits lately [2] except the addition of a .gitignore file in 2019. And there seems to be a confusion with the GitHub projects, because there are two of them [3][4]. One with four pull requests. PR 2 and PR 4 try to solve the same issue where the serializer mangles high-surrogate UTF-16 characters (-> emojis) [5][6]. The related XALANJ-2617 tracker entry [7] seems to be a pressing issue, but there's no new release to fix this yet. The bug tracker [8] has 257 open issues, some dating back to the beginning of this century.

Is Xalan-J a candidate for the attic?
